Letter to the editor: Free market health care best choice

Ryan Dashek's March 10th article says that some people argue for socialized medicine while opponents think what we have now is best. This misrepresents the alternatives.  

 

Our current health-care system is one form of government-controlled health care. Government dictates what services must be covered (such as the recent bills mandating coverage for autism and other mental illnesses), forces hospitals to provide certain services regardless of whether they expect to be paid and dumps huge sums of taxpayer money into the system via Medicare and Medicaid. Such interventions, and many more like them, are the cause of spiraling health-care costs. 

 

Advocating further government involvement in health care is just asking for more of the same disease. The real alternative is free-market health care; the same (relatively) free market that continually produces computers and other electronic devices at lower cost and higher quality.
